The Elephant Whisperers is a short documentary directed by Kartiki Gonsalves now streaming on Netflix.

If you like nature and elephants, don’t miss it, for your will love this documentary. Follow Raghu’s development in this interesting and spectacular feature.

The Elephant Whisperers follows an indigenous couple as they fall in love with Raghu, an orphaned elephant given into their care, and tirelessly work to ensure his recovery & survival. The film highlights the beauty of the wild spaces in South India and the people and animals who share this space.

About the Documentary

In the National Park of Medumalai, India, there are people who live far away from the big metropolis, co-habitating with nature.

Passed on from generation to generation they devote their lives to take care of the forest habitat and are known as the “Kings of the forest”.

The big protagonist in this story is the baby elephant Raghu, who is adopted by the caretaker and his future wife in the elephant rehabilitation camp. The bond formed is that of parents and child, which leads to heartbreak when the forest officers decide to separate Raghu from his “family”. Filmed in 2019 and counting on beautiful photography we are teleported, during a mere 40 minutes, to this spectacular place.

It is a wonderful documentary that aims straight for the heart.
